Do Not Hurt Yourself
One night a snake entered a carpenters workshop while it was looking for
food.
The carpenter was a rather untidy man who had left several tools scattered
on the floor.
One of them was a saw. As the snake was crawling he went over the saw which
gave him a little cut.
At once, thinking that the saw was attacking him, he turned around and bit
the saw to get even with it and have his revenge. He bit the saw so hard
that his mouth started to bleed.
This made him more angry. He attacked the saw again and again until the saw
was covered with blood.
Finally he stopped thinking that the saw was dead. Dying from his own
wounds, the snake was not satisfied having taken his revenge and further
decided to give one last hard bite and squeeze the saw by winding itself
across, as tight as he could, before he left.
The next morning the carpenter was surprised to find a dead snake on his
doorstep.
Lesson to Learn:
Sometimes in trying to hurt others, we only hurt ourselves*
